About the Role

Join Hire Resolve’s client in Wellington is seeking a skilled Concrete Foreman to oversee concrete construction projects. As a leading company in the civil road construction industry, they require a talented individual to manage and coordinate all aspects of concrete construction, ensuring project timelines and quality standards are met.

Key Responsibilities

  • Organize labour and materials for concrete construction projects
  • Supervise construction teams
  • Ensure project timelines and quality standards are met

Requirements

  • Minimum of 5 years’ experience as a Concrete Foreman in civil road construction
  • Strong knowledge of concrete construction techniques and materials
  • Ability to read and interpret construction drawings and specifications
  • Proven leadership and communication skills
  • Ability to manage and coordinate construction teams
  • Knowledge of safety regulations and procedures in construction
  • Valid driver’s license
  • Preferably a resident of Wellington or willing to relocate
